How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Black Creek?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Black Creek Studio Apartments | $1,675 | $1,500 | $1,775 |
| Black Creek 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,013 | $1,750 | $2,500 |
| Black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,523 | $2,149 | $3,000 |
| Black Creek 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,911 | $2,589 | $3,300 |
| Black Creek 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,650 | $3,650 | $3,650 |
